📖 Key Verse:

Nehemiah 2:18 – “Let us rise up and build. So they strengthened their hands for the good work.”


Devotional:

Revival is not a spectator sport. It’s a construction site, and heaven is handing out bricks. When Nehemiah heard about the broken walls of Jerusalem, he didn’t complain. He didn’t post about it. He wept, fasted, prayed… and then picked up tools. God is not just looking for mourners—He’s looking for builders. People who will take personal responsibility and say: “If no one else builds, I will.”


📖 Scripture Reading:

1 Corinthians 3:10 – “Each one should build with care…”


💧 Refreshing for the Day:

Beloved, there’s a portion of the wall with your name on it. It might be prayer. It might be truth. It might be discipleship. It might be rebuilding purity in your generation. But you’ve been called to rebuild something. Nehemiah didn’t do it alone—he led a remnant who strengthened their hands for the work. You don’t need to do everything. But you do need to build your part. So. ask God: “Where is the wall You’ve assigned me to?” Whether it’s your family, your ministry, or your generation—strengthen your hands for that work.
